WebIf you don't have coverage, you have a few options for getting low-cost or free exams and eyeglasses. These include participating in a vision discount program, buying eyeglasses online and working with charities that provide free and low-cost vision care services.

WebYou should get a range of frame styles to choose from at this price point, but the frames can feel somewhat flimsy. Mid-priced: For $50 to $100, you can find a huge variety of eyeglasses with any frame shape you can think of. They should feel sturdy and look good. Expensive: High-end frames cost between $100 and $400. Web10 mei 2024 · Colorblind glasses have special lenses that enhance the wearer’s perception of red and green specifically. Red-green color blindness is the most common type, so these glasses usually address this issue, though there are glasses that also correct for blue-yellow color blindness.
